Baldwin County Schools offers voluntary life and accidental death and dismemberment (AD&D) insurance at affordable group insurance rates through Voya Financial. You may elect life insurance, AD&D insurance, or both. You must elect the minimum amount of voluntary life insurance (1x salary) in order to elect AD&D. The AD&D benefit pays in the event of death or loss of limbs, speech, hearing, and more caused by a covered accident.

As a new hire, you may elect some coverage without answering health questions, known as the Guarantee Issue (GI). The GI amounts are as follows:
Should you elect an amount that exceeds the Guarantee Issue, an Evidence of Insurability (EOI) form will be required for underwriting review. You will not be charged for an amount that exceeds the Guarantee Issue unless you are approved.
During enrollment, you must review your life insurance beneficiary. The beneficiary is the person you designate to receive your life insurance benefits upon your passing. Your beneficiary can be a person or multiple people, a charitable institution, or your estate. Once named, your beneficiary remains on file until you make a change.
Coverage continuation options are available in the event of employment separation. If you wish to continue your coverage upon separation, you must contact Voya Financial within 30 days of separation. You must elect portability coverage before age 70, and it terminates at age 80. Portability rates differ from active employee rates.
